/* Interrupt nesting behaviour configuration. Cortex-M specific. */
|
|
#ifdef __NVIC_PRIO_BITS
|
|
/* __BVIC_PRIO_BITS will be specified when CMSIS is being used. */
|
|
#define configPRIO_BITS __NVIC_PRIO_BITS
|
|
#else
|
|
#define configPRIO_BITS 4 /* 15 priority levels */
|
|
#endif
|
|
|
|
/* The lowest interrupt priority that can be used in a call to a "set priority"
|
|
function. */
|
|
#define configLIBRARY_LOWEST_INTERRUPT_PRIORITY ((1U << (configPRIO_BITS)) - 1)
|
|
|
|
/* The highest interrupt priority that can be used by any interrupt service
|
|
routine that makes calls to interrupt safe FreeRTOS API functions. DO NOT CALL
|
|
INTERRUPT SAFE FREERTOS API FUNCTIONS FROM ANY INTERRUPT THAT HAS A HIGHER
|
|
PRIORITY THAN THIS! (higher priorities are lower numeric values. */
|
|
#define configLIBRARY_MAX_SYSCALL_INTERRUPT_PRIORITY 2
|
|
|
|
/* Interrupt priorities used by the kernel port layer itself. These are generic
|
|
to all Cortex-M ports, and do not rely on any particular library functions. */
|
|
#define configKERNEL_INTERRUPT_PRIORITY (configLIBRARY_LOWEST_INTERRUPT_PRIORITY << (8 - configPRIO_BITS))
|
|
/* !!!! configMAX_SYSCALL_INTERRUPT_PRIORITY must not be set to zero !!!!
|
|
See http://www.FreeRTOS.org/RTOS-Cortex-M3-M4.html. */
|
|
#define configMAX_SYSCALL_INTERRUPT_PRIORITY (configLIBRARY_MAX_SYSCALL_INTERRUPT_PRIORITY << (8 - configPRIO_BITS))
|
|
|
|
/* Definitions that map the FreeRTOS port interrupt handlers to their CMSIS
|
|
standard names. */
|
|
#define vPortSVCHandler SVC_Handler
|
|
#define xPortPendSVHandler PendSV_Handler
|
|
#define xPortSysTickHandler SysTick_Handler
